Output 7f0c3d6b577ced523c60bf2b42cf68bc22e1fa2a8b02fa832cbeb1e1ab2a4e85:0

value
6943400347986
script pubkey
OP_0 OP_PUSHBYTES_20 1a8df34a2031db819b98b831bf3315d11248c58a
address
tb1qr2xlxj3qx8dcrxuchqcm7vc46yfy33v2awhan8
transaction
7f0c3d6b577ced523c60bf2b42cf68bc22e1fa2a8b02fa832cbeb1e1ab2a4e85
confirmations
168882
spent
true